About the Department of Conservation and Recreation:
The Department of Conservation and Recreation manages one of the largest and most diverse state parks systems in the nation and protects and enhances natural resources and outdoor recreational opportunities throughout Massachusetts. The DCR system includes over 450,000 acres of parks, forests, water supply protection lands, beaches, lakes, ponds, playgrounds, campgrounds, swimming pools, golf courses, skating rinks, trails and parkways.

DUTIES:
Inspects recreation facilities to determine the need for repair work and performs maintenance and repair of all facilities and infrastructure including but not limited to painting, mowing, brush trimming, tree removal and building and equipment maintenance.
Reviews blueprints, plans, schematics and/or technical manuals for maintenance purposes.
Operates hand power tools, generators, tractors, mowers and associated equipment in connection with repair work and maintenance of bicycle trails, fire lanes, gates, fencing and buildings.
Picks up supplies needed for maintenance and repair work.
Performs related duties as assigned.
